| Diagonal 1 Star Diagonal |
An attachment for a small telescope, containing a small plane mirror or prism, used to turn through a right angle the beam of light in the telescope and the direction of the draw-tube into which the eyepiece is inserted. Use of a diagonal may be helpful when the visual user of a small amateur telescope would have difficulty accessing the eyepiece in its normal tube. However, there is some loss of light when a further optical element is introduced, and there may also be loss of image quality. The image in a diagonal is reversed right-to-left.
